Find Jobs
Hire Freelancers

ELASTIX Customization

$150-350 USD

Closed
Posted over 10 years ago

$150-350 USD

Paid on delivery
PRODUCT: Elastix (latest version) - REQUIREMENT: The creation of script that be run after the initial setup of the Elastix ISO image and it will perform several changes inside the system in order to: a) Limit access to some areas of the system (i.e disable editing Network Settings form inside the Elastix) b) Limit some of the functionality of the FreePBX module (see below) ======= Pseudo-code of the script that must limit access to the TRUNKS section: Question of script during runtime: "Do you want to limit the Trunks to 1? Yes/No If YES: Please provide trunk settings: Sip server name?: Sip user name?: Sip Password?: Nat?: DTMF:? Maximum Channels:? (the script here creates the trunk. The users afterwards (including admin) can ONLY read the trunk on a read-only basis. No chages to any part) If NO: (perform no change since there will be no limitation. ======= Other functionality to be limited is the amount of extensions that the users will be able to add. (The permitted amounts will be in increments of 5 eg 5,10,15,20 extensions etc. IMPORTANT: The users (incl admin) of the Elastix system must not be able to overcome ANY of those limitations. You do not only need to edit the PHP files and remove the links form the Elastix interface, You need to take appropriate actions in order to make sure that the users will not be able to inject code. Note that that they will NOT be given access to ports SSH and MYSQL and will only be able to manage the system via the web interface of Elastix. Also you need to disable web-based SSH from inside FreePBX >> Other changes are required as well so for full detauls please bid and get in tough with me. >> Milestones: (non negotiable) 1 Milestone only. 100% payment on successfull testing >> Delivery: MAX 2 Weeks. Every day that passes after the dealine will carry a 3.5% deduction of the total amount. THIS IS CONTINUOUS BUSINESS: It goes without saying that your services will be needed again, when there is an update to the Elastix Package (or FreePBX and related software). You therefore need to keep this mind when quoting for this project. Thank you
Project ID: 4846506

About the project

1 proposal
Remote project
Active 11 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

About the client

Flag of UNITED KINGDOM
London, United Kingdom
5.0
3
Member since Mar 24, 2010

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.